⚜️ Berserker ⚜️



First of all, if you're looking for the BEST fully Python obfuscator, you should check Hyperion!

An unique Python3 obfuscator using Kyrie Eleison's
encryption protocol, written in Python3.

If you're searching for a more advanced obfuscator, check Kramer, it's
using the same algorithm as Berserker, but it's more advanced.



📋 Examples 📋



Unobfuscated:

input("Hello there!")



Obfuscated:

class Berserker():
 def __init__(self:object,_encode:str=False,_bytes:bool=0,*_system:int,**_boom:int)->exec:
  self._bit,self._exit,self._delete,self._bits,_boom[_bytes],_encode=lambda _decode:"".join(chr(int(_byte)-len(_decode.split('|')))if _byte!='§'else'ζ'for _byte in str(_decode).split('|')),lambda _encode:str(_boom[_bytes](f"{self._delete[4]+self._delete[-13]+self._delete[4]+self._delete[2]}(''.join(%s),{self._delete[6]+self._delete[11]+self._delete[14]+self._delete[1]+self._delete[0]+self._delete[11]+self._delete[18]}())"%list(_encode))).encode(self._delete[20]+self._delete[19]+self._delete[5]+self._delete[34])if _boom[_bytes]==eval else exit(),exit()if _encode else'abcdefghijklmnopqrstuvwxyz0123456789',lambda _rasputin:_encode(_rasputin),eval,lambda _encode:exit()if self._delete[15]+self._delete[17]+self._delete[8]+self._delete[13]+self._delete[19] in open(__file__, errors=self._delete[8]+self._delete[6]+self._delete[13]+self._delete[14]+self._delete[17]+self._delete[4]).read() or self._delete[8]+self._delete[13]+self._delete[15]+self._delete[20]+self._delete[19] in open(__file__, errors=self._delete[8]+self._delete[6]+self._delete[13]+self._delete[14]+self._delete[17]+self._delete[4]).read()else"".join(_encode if _encode not in self._delete else self._delete[self._delete.index(_encode)+1 if self._delete.index(_encode)+1<len(self._delete)else 0]for _encode in "".join(chr(ord(t)-928707)if t!="ζ"else"\n"for t in self._bit(_encode)))
  return self.__decode__(_boom[(self._delete[-1]+'_')[-1]+self._delete[18]+self._delete[15]+self._delete[0]+self._delete[17]+self._delete[10]+self._delete[11]+self._delete[4]])
 def __decode__(self,_execute: str)->exec:return(None,self._exit(self._bits(_execute)))[0]
Berserker(_encode=False,_sparkle='''928832|928837|928839|928844|928843|928768|928762|928800|928828|928835|928835|928838|928760|928843|928831|928828|928841|928828|928761|928762|928769''')






⭐ Features ⭐



+ Fast execution
+ Good obfuscation
+ Small file size


- You can't choose your own encryption key
